Python 人马兽的功能与应用:探索其强大之处
在当今的科技领域,Python 无疑是一颗耀眼的明星。它以其简洁、高效、易学易用等诸多优势,成为了众多开发者钟爱的编程语言。而 Python 所展现出的强大功能和广泛的应用场景,更是令人惊叹不已。将深入探讨 Python 人马兽的功能与应用,揭示其强大之处。
Python 具有简洁清晰的语法结构。相比于其他一些编程语言,Python 的代码风格简洁明了,易于阅读和理解。这使得开发者能够更加快速地编写代码,提高开发效率。无论是处理简单的任务还是构建复杂的系统,Python 都能轻松胜任。其语法规则相对简单,没有过多的繁琐细节,让初学者能够迅速上手,而对于有经验的开发者来说,也能更加灵活地运用各种特性来实现自己的想法。
强大的数据分析和处理能力是 Python 的一大亮点。通过丰富的数据分析库,如 NumPy、Pandas、Scikit-learn 等,Python 能够高效地进行数据的加载、清洗、转换和分析。它可以处理大规模的数据,进行数据可视化,挖掘数据中的潜在模式和规律。无论是在金融领域进行风险分析、在科学研究中处理实验数据,还是在电商行业进行用户行为分析,Python 都发挥着重要的作用。它为数据分析工作者提供了强大的工具,帮助他们更好地理解和利用数据。
在机器学习和人工智能领域,Python 更是占据了重要的地位。众多的机器学习框架,如 TensorFlow、PyTorch 等,都是基于 Python 开发的。Python 提供了便捷的接口和丰富的算法实现,使得开发者能够快速构建和训练各种机器学习模型。无论是图像识别、自然语言处理、语音识别还是推荐系统,Python 都能为这些领域的研究和应用提供有力支持。它使得机器学习不再是高门槛的技术,而是让更多的人能够参与其中,推动人工智能技术的发展和应用。
Web 开发也是 Python 的重要应用领域之一。使用 Python 的 Web 框架,如 Django 和 Flask 等,可以快速构建功能强大的 Web 应用程序。这些框架提供了完善的路由、模板引擎、数据库连接等功能,使得开发者能够专注于业务逻辑的实现,而不必过多地关注底层的 Web 技术细节。Python 在 Web 开发方面的灵活性和高效性,使其成为了许多企业和项目的首选语言。
除了以上提到的领域,Python 还在自动化测试、游戏开发、科学计算等众多方面有着广泛的应用。它的跨平台性使得代码可以在不同的操作系统上运行,进一步拓展了其应用范围。
那么,Python 人马兽的功能与应用如此强大,我们在实际应用中应该如何充分发挥它的优势呢?要深入学习和掌握 Python 的各种库和框架,了解它们的特点和用法。要不断积累实践经验,通过实际项目来提升自己的编程能力和解决问题的能力。要关注 Python 社区的发展和最新的技术动态,及时学习和应用新的技术和方法。

接下来提出几个相关问题并解答:
问题一:Python 在数据分析领域有哪些常用的库?
解答:Python 在数据分析领域有很多常用的库,如 NumPy 用于数组操作和科学计算,Pandas 用于数据帧的处理和分析,Scikit-learn 用于机器学习算法的实现,Matplotlib 和 Seaborn 用于数据可视化等。
问题二:机器学习中常见的模型有哪些?
解答:机器学习中常见的模型有线性回归、逻辑回归、决策树、随机森林、支持向量机、神经网络等。
问题三:Python 用于 Web 开发的优势是什么?
解答:Python 用于 Web 开发的优势包括语法简洁清晰、丰富的 Web 框架提供完善的功能、跨平台性、拥有庞大的开发者社区和丰富的资源等。
参考文献:
[1] Python 官方文档.
[2] Python 数据分析基础.
[3] 机器学习实战.
[4] Django 权威指南.
[5] Flask 微框架实战.